Diploma in Stress Management at Sea
Why this certificate program?
The Diploma in Stress Management at Sea
This program provides you with the essential tools to face the unique challenges of the maritime environment. Learn to identify, understand, and mitigate the factors that contribute to stress, improving your well-being and professional performance on board. This program will equip you with practical strategies and techniques for emotional management, effective communication, and resilience, optimizing decision-making under pressure and fostering a safe and healthy work environment.
